1
0
mirror of https://github.com/rancher/types.git synced 2025-09-23 10:57:13 +00:00

generated changes

This commit is contained in:
Prachi Damle
2019-08-21 14:37:41 -07:00
committed by Alena Prokharchyk
parent 9d2b59dedc
commit 9505a1672e

View File

@@ -54,6 +54,10 @@ type ClusterTemplateRevisionOperations interface {
ByID(id string) (*ClusterTemplateRevision, error)
Delete(container *ClusterTemplateRevision) error
ActionDisable(resource *ClusterTemplateRevision) error
ActionEnable(resource *ClusterTemplateRevision) error
CollectionActionListquestions(resource *ClusterTemplateRevisionCollection) (*ClusterTemplateQuestionsOutput, error)
}
@@ -108,6 +112,16 @@ func (c *ClusterTemplateRevisionClient) Delete(container *ClusterTemplateRevisio
return c.apiClient.Ops.DoResourceDelete(ClusterTemplateRevisionType, &container.Resource)
}
func (c *ClusterTemplateRevisionClient) ActionDisable(resource *ClusterTemplateRevision) error {
err := c.apiClient.Ops.DoAction(ClusterTemplateRevisionType, "disable", &resource.Resource, nil, nil)
return err
}
func (c *ClusterTemplateRevisionClient) ActionEnable(resource *ClusterTemplateRevision) error {
err := c.apiClient.Ops.DoAction(ClusterTemplateRevisionType, "enable", &resource.Resource, nil, nil)
return err
}
func (c *ClusterTemplateRevisionClient) CollectionActionListquestions(resource *ClusterTemplateRevisionCollection) (*ClusterTemplateQuestionsOutput, error) {
resp := &ClusterTemplateQuestionsOutput{}
err := c.apiClient.Ops.DoCollectionAction(ClusterTemplateRevisionType, "listquestions", &resource.Collection, nil, resp)